Comptonatus chasei - new species of iguanodontian
"the most complete dinosaur discovered in the UK in a hundred years", or to put it another way, the most complete ornithopod dinosaur found on the Isle of Wight since Mantellisaurus in 1914. Named after Compton Bay and Nick Chase, where it was found and by whom respectively.
